## Approvals: Thankspool receipt mailer

Any change to the donation-receipt mailer requires sign-off before deploy, since it sends tax-relevant documents. This includes template edits, currency formatting, and changes to the retry queue. Standard process: open a change request, attach rendered samples for at least three locales, and get approval recorded in the tracker. Emergency fixes still need retroactive review within 24 hours. Approval authority for Thankspool currently rests with:

named custodian: Brivan Eliath Quenox Frador

## Changelog — Quillstack 1.9

Welcome, new folks — quick note on a rename. The old REBUILD_KEY setting confused everyone because it sounded like a secret but actually just toggled incremental static rebuilds. It's now QUILLSTACK_INCREMENTAL=true, which is clearer. The actual secret — the token that lets the rebuild worker pull content from the Fernwood CMS — is a separate line in .env and is genuinely sensitive, so don't paste it in tickets. When setting up your local env file, put that token on the line right after the incremental flag.

sealed setting: ARCHIVE_KEY3=8d0

Subject: Spare hardware storage — reminder

Hi all,

A quick note from the front desk at Wrenmoor Place: spare keyboards, headsets, and chargers for visitors are now kept in Storage Room C, behind the copy alcove. Please record anything issued in the loans book on the shelf inside. The room is locked at all times, and the current door code is:

door code, yagap-bahof: bdg-O-05

## Onboarding Note: Timezones in Report Exports (Draywell Analytics)

All Draywell report exports are stored in UTC and converted at render time using the workspace's locale setting — never the server clock. If a reviewer sees hardcoded offsets, flag it. To run the export test harness locally, unlock the fixtures bundle with the passphrase below.

strongbox words: prawyn-fenmir